Community Health Specialist — Career Guide

They promote health within the community by helping individuals adopt healthy behaviors. They serve as an advocate for individuals' health needs by helping community residents effectively communicate with healthcare providers or social service agencies. They act as a liaison or advocate who implements or advocates for programs that promote, maintain, and improve individual and overall community health. They may provide preventive health-related services such as blood pressure, glaucoma, and hearing screenings. They may collect data to help identify community health needs.
